The golden era of Hollywood brought the world a plethora of talented performers who captivated audiences with their charm, talent, and on-screen charisma. From legendary icons like Marilyn Monroe and James Dean to beloved stars like Audrey Hepburn and Marlon Brando, the 1950s introduced us to a new breed of actors who left an indelible mark on cinema and television alike.
